Delve into the rich histories of South, East, and Southeast Asia, Africa, and the Americas, alongside broader narratives of imperialism, decolonization, migration, conflict, humanitarian efforts, and globalization.
As one of the UK's premier institutions for postgraduate studies in global, international, and imperial histories, our History Department boasts world-renowned specialists in these regions. The MA in Global History leverages this expertise to offer profound insights into the forces that have shaped our world, allowing you to examine connections, contrasts, and exchanges across vast geographical and temporal landscapes while analyzing the interplay between global, regional, and local dynamics.
Our MA programs are crafted to support specialized research under expert guidance within a welcoming academic community.
The foundational module enhances your grasp of crucial historiographical methods and source analysis techniques, while the Dissertation component lets you refine these skills through independent research. This is complemented by the Research Presentation module, which hones your ability to communicate complex historical concepts to general audiences.
Career prospects
A History MA significantly expands your transferable skill set. You'll enjoy the flexibility to customize your research focus while prioritizing the competencies most valuable to your goals. Our specialized modules in public history—including Presenting the Past and practical work placements—deliver authentic professional experience.
These sought-after skills explain why our alumni thrive in diverse fields, from academia and cultural heritage sectors to corporate leadership, marketing, legal professions, and media careers.
We provide customized guidance for students aspiring to pursue PhD studies after completing their MA.
